A Local Government Authority in London is looking for an experienced Microsoft Fabric Architect to provide strategic and technical leadership for its enterprise data and analytics platform. Working with the Data and Platforms Team, you will review and strengthen the platform architecture, governance framework and operating model. This is a senior architecture and governance role, requiring a holistic view of data design, security, service operation and organisational adoption. It is not primarily a data engineering or report development position.
Essential Experience
- Proven experience designing, reviewing and implementing enterprise-scale Microsoft Fabric solutions
- Strong knowledge of OneLake, Lakehouses, Warehouses, notebooks, pipelines, dataflows, semantic models and Power BI
- Experience defining enterprise data architecture and governance frameworks
